Living a healthy life involves maintaining a balance of physical, mental, and emotional well-being. Here are some detailed tips and practices to help you lead a healthy lifestyle:
1. Balanced Diet
- Nutrition: Consume a variety of foods to get a range of nutrients. Include f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ats in your diet.
- Hydration: Drink plenty of water throughout the day. Proper hydration is crucial for bodily functions.
- Portion Control: Be mindful of portion sizes to avoid overeating. Eating smaller, more frequent meals can help maintain energy levels.
- Limit Processed Foods: Reduce intake of processed foods, sugary drinks, and excessive salt. Opt for natural, whole foods whenever possible.
2. Regular Exercise
- Aerobic Exercise: Engage in activities like walking, running, cycling, or swimming for at least 150 minutes a week.
- Strength Training: Incorporate strength training exercises at least twice a week to build and maintain muscle mass.
- Flexibility and Balance: Include activities like yoga or stretching exercises to improve flexibility and balance.
- Consistency: Make exercise a regular part of your routine. Find activities you enjoy to stay motivated.
3. Adequate Sleep
- Sleep Schedule: Maintain a consistent sleep schedule by going to bed and waking up at the same times every day.
- Sleep Environment: Create a comfortable sleep environment with a cool, dark, and quiet room.
- Avoid Stimulants: Limit caffeine and electronic device use before bedtime to promote better sleep quality.
- Relaxation Techniques: Practice relaxation techniques like deep breathing, meditation, or reading before bed to help unwind.
